Each applicant must submit:
Duration: 20 seconds
Orientation: Portrait / Vertical
Resolution: 1080 × 1920 minimum
Aspect Ratio: 9:16
FPS: 24 or 30
The beginning and ending frames must transition naturally.
Viewer should not notice:
jumps
cuts
lighting shifts
cloud resets
camera resets
wave mismatches
fog popping
object teleportation

Avoid:
overly dramatic AI lighting
fake god rays
unnatural motion
hyper-saturated colors
floating artifacts
melting textures
impossible physics
Nature should move subtly and naturally.
Preferred:
locked camera
ultra slow drift
subtle cinematic movement
Avoid:
fast motion
aggressive parallax
drone-style movement
chaotic motion
Looping becomes difficult with excessive movement.

The loop quality matters more than visual complexity.
A viewer should be able to watch:
5 minutes
30 minutes
even 1 hour
without detecting the loop.
Applicants may use:
reverse blending
crossfade looping
latent blending
AI interpolation
masked transitions
cyclic camera paths
manual compositing
